Mary “Tookie” Louise Fant, 80, of Texarkana, Arkansas, was born November 12, 1944, in Garland, Arkansas, and passed away peacefully at home on June 29, 2025, surrounded by her loving family.
She was preceded in death by her parents, Jessie Maidwell and Robert Fant; her sisters, Peggy Lafayette and Frances Frost; and her brothers, James and Bud Fant.
She is survived by her daughter, Barbara Fant; granddaughters, Jeanette Leflett and Ashley Rouw; and five great-grandsons, Jace Leflett, Isaiah Rouw, Jaylen Daniel, Aiden Rouw, and Grayson McGowan. She also leaves behind many nieces and nephews who loved her dearly.
Affectionately known as “Tookie,” Mary was one of the sweetest, most selfless souls you could ever meet. She never hesitated to lend a hand and had a heart big enough for everyone. She loved watching Charlie's Angels, Hunter, and John Wayne movies, and enjoyed the simple comforts of home and family.
Services will be held on Saturday, July 12, 2025, at Living Hope United Pentecostal Church, 104 W Beech St, Fouke, AR 71837. Visitation begins at 1:00 PM with the service to follow at 2:00 PM. Cremation will take place afterward.
Arrangements are entrusted to Tri-State Cremation and Funeral Services.
